The average price of electricity in United Kingdom, in December of 2020, has been 0.2203€ per kilowatt hour. Electricity price has not changed since the last semester. Meanwhile, the average price of electricity without taxes in United Kingdom in that period was € 0.1532 per kilowatt hour,, as in the previous period.
In the last twelve months the price of electricity in United Kingdom has increased by 1.32%.
From 2007 until now, the highest price of electricity in United Kingdom has been € 0.221 kWh, in December of 2019, while in June of 2010, electricity price was € 0.1386 kWh, its minimum price in this period.
United Kingdom is among the European countries with the most expensive electricity.
Finally, if we compare the price of electricity with taxes and without taxes, we see that, in the last period, households paid € 0.0671 of taxes for each kilowatt hour, which means that 30.46% of what households pay for the electricity are taxes.
